黑狐家游戏

什么是负载均衡技术,深入解析负载均衡解决方案,技术原理与实际应用

欧气 1 0

本文目录导读:

什么是负载均衡技术,深入解析负载均衡解决方案,技术原理与实际应用

图片来源于网络,如有侵权联系删除

  1. 什么是负载均衡?
  2. 负载均衡技术原理
  3. 负载均衡解决方案
  4. 负载均衡实际应用

什么是负载均衡?

负载均衡(Load Balancing)是指将网络流量分配到多个服务器或资源上,以实现高效、稳定的系统运行,在互联网、云计算等领域,负载均衡技术已成为保障系统性能和可用性的重要手段,负载均衡就是让多个服务器分担工作,避免单个服务器承受过高压力,从而提高整体性能。

负载均衡技术原理

1、工作原理

负载均衡技术通过以下步骤实现:

(1)收集服务器性能数据,包括CPU、内存、磁盘等资源使用情况;

(2)根据预设的算法,如轮询、最少连接数、IP哈希等,将请求分发到不同的服务器;

(3)服务器处理请求,并将结果返回给客户端;

(4)持续监控服务器性能,根据实际情况调整负载分配策略。

2、算法分类

(1)轮询(Round Robin):按照顺序将请求分发到各个服务器,当服务器数量增加时,请求分发更加均匀;

(2)最少连接数(Least Connections):将请求分发到连接数最少的服务器,降低服务器压力;

(3)IP哈希(IP Hash):根据客户端IP地址,将请求分发到相同的服务器,提高会话保持率;

(4)最小响应时间(Least Response Time):将请求分发到响应时间最短的服务器,提高系统响应速度。

负载均衡解决方案

1、硬件负载均衡器

什么是负载均衡技术,深入解析负载均衡解决方案,技术原理与实际应用

图片来源于网络,如有侵权联系删除

硬件负载均衡器是一种专门为负载均衡设计的设备,具有高性能、高可靠性的特点,其主要优势如下:

(1)支持多种协议,如HTTP、HTTPS、TCP、UDP等;

(2)具备高并发处理能力,满足大规模业务需求;

(3)支持多级负载均衡,提高系统容错能力。

2、软件负载均衡器

软件负载均衡器是在服务器软件中实现负载均衡功能,如Nginx、HAProxy等,其主要优势如下:

(1)开源免费,易于部署和维护;

(2)支持跨平台部署,适用于不同操作系统;

(3)可扩展性强,可根据业务需求进行定制。

3、云负载均衡

云负载均衡是将负载均衡功能部署在云计算平台上,如阿里云、腾讯云等,其主要优势如下:

(1)弹性伸缩,根据业务需求自动调整资源;

(2)高可用性,保障系统稳定运行;

什么是负载均衡技术,深入解析负载均衡解决方案,技术原理与实际应用

图片来源于网络,如有侵权联系删除

(3)降低运维成本,提高运维效率。

负载均衡实际应用

1、互联网应用

在互联网领域,负载均衡技术广泛应用于以下场景:

(1)电商平台:提高网站并发访问能力,保障用户购物体验;

(2)在线教育:实现大规模用户同时在线,满足教学需求;

(3)直播平台:提高直播画质和流畅度,保障用户观看体验。

2、云计算应用

在云计算领域,负载均衡技术可应用于以下场景:

(1)虚拟机集群:实现虚拟机资源的合理分配,提高资源利用率;

(2)容器化应用:优化容器调度策略,提高应用性能;

(3)分布式存储:实现存储资源的均衡访问,提高存储性能。

负载均衡解决方案是保障系统性能和可用性的重要手段,通过深入理解负载均衡技术原理和应用场景,选择合适的负载均衡方案,可有效提高系统性能、降低运维成本,在实际应用中,应根据业务需求和资源条件,选择合适的负载均衡技术,为用户提供优质的服务体验。

标签: #什么是负载均衡解决方案是什么

黑狐家游戏
  • 评论列表

留言评论